Cold Air Intake Upgrade 
Alrighty, so I got a JLT Cold Air Intake, following the instructions I disconnected the battery.

I then went about removing the standard intake, there were three bolts I had to take off, then disconnect the IAF and the MAF (push pins) and loosen the zip tube.

Once I got it all removed, I went ahead and cleaned out the area wiping it down with a wet rag.

So I took the intake out, removed the MAF and bolted it onto the new intake.

Here it is all installed, the intake bolts with a bracket to one of stock intake mounts.  So I took it out for a nice long spin to Lake Travis...  I have to say it is totally impressed me, I am very satisfied with the results.  I even took the cover off the engine and pulled on the throttle cable, the woosh of the intake really caught me off guard (in a good way).  Life is good:)
